Nutritional Information
Approximate values per serving (based on 12 servings, using full‑fat dairy):
- Calories: 210
- Carbohydrates: 3g
- Protein: 8g
- Fat: 19g
- Saturated Fat: 9g
- Fiber: 0g
- Sugar: 2g
- Sodium: 350mg
Using low‑fat cream cheese, sour cream, and mayo will lower the calories and fat content.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I use a food processor to make this spread?
A: Yes. A food processor makes quick work of blending the ingredients. Just be careful not to overprocess – you want the bacon and cheese to remain in small chunks for texture.
Q: Can I use a different type of cheese?
A: Yes. You can use any cheese that melts well – Gouda, Monterey Jack, pepper jack, or a blend of your favorites.
Q: Can I make this spread ahead of time?
A: Yes. In fact, it’s better when made ahead. The flavors meld and deepen in the fridge for 1–2 days.
Q: Can I use turkey bacon instead of regular bacon?
A: Yes. Turkey bacon works well and is a lighter option. Cook it until crispy before crumbling.
Q: Can I add other vegetables to this spread?
A: Yes. Finely chopped bell peppers, jalapeños, or even caramelized onions are all great additions.
Q: Can I make this dairy‑free?
A: Yes. Use dairy‑free cream cheese, dairy‑free sour cream, and vegan mayonnaise. The texture will be slightly different but still delicious.
Q: How long does this spread last in the fridge?
A: It will last for up to 1 week in the refrigerator.
Q: Can I freeze this spread?
A: It’s not recommended – the texture becomes watery and grainy upon thawing.
Q: What’s the best way to serve this spread at a party?
A: Serve it in a nice bowl with a variety of dippers – crackers, bagel chips, and fresh vegetables. Garnish with extra bacon and chives for a beautiful presentation.
